Output d6122b86d5d5ab426f4518ce660a5e8940e857536181853651a7d8686799b88c:3

value
634869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ef211b23435535bb72ae376d3cfc02995d9155f6 OP_EQUAL
address
3PVR5dtoH6q5YJMT1DJsKdqcj9K3ZLXB2S
transaction
d6122b86d5d5ab426f4518ce660a5e8940e857536181853651a7d8686799b88c
spent
true